A method is presented to predict the complete stress-strain curve of concrete subjected to traxial compressive stresses caused by axial load plus lateral pressure due to the confinement action in circular, box and octagonal shaped concrete-filled steel tubes. Available empirical formulas are adopted to determine the lateral pressure exerted on concrete in circular concrete-filled steel Columns. To evaluate the lateral pressure exerted on the concrete on the concrete in box and octagonal shaped columns, FEM analysis is adopted With the help of a concrete-steel interaction model.
